2011-11-11 49 views
0

原因: 1. eclipseからsvn respに接続します。 - JVMはSEGVすることになっていませんubuntuで致命的なエラーが発生する

# 
# A fatal error has been detected by the Java Runtime Environment: 
# 
# SIGSEGV (0xb) at pc=0x00007feaeed0c1c0, pid=29042, tid=140646465390352 
# 
# JRE version: 6.0 
# Java VM: OpenJDK 64-Bit Server VM (19.0-b09 mixed mode linux-amd64 compressed oops) 
# Problematic frame: 
# C [ld-linux-x86-64.so.2+0x11c0] 
... 
Java frames: (J=compiled Java code, j=interpreted, Vv=VM code) 
j org.tigris.subversion.javahl.SVNClient.info2(Ljava/lang/String;Lorg/tigris/subversion/javahl/Revision;Lorg/tigris/subversion/javahl/Revision;I[Ljava/lang/String;Lorg/tigris/subversion/javahl/InfoCallback;)V+0 
j org.tigris.subversion.javahl.SVNClient.info2(Ljava/lang/String;Lorg/tigris/subversion/javahl/Revision;Lorg/tigris/subversion/javahl/Revision;Z)[Lorg/tigris/subversion/javahl/Info2;+23 
j org.tigris.subversion.svnclientadapter.javahl.AbstractJhlClientAdapter.getInfo(Lorg/tigris/subversion/svnclientadapter/SVNUrl;Lorg/tigris/subversion/svnclientadapter/SVNRevision;Lorg/tigris/subversion/svnclientadapter/SVNRevision;) 
... 
--------------- T H R E A D --------------- 
Current thread (0x00007feadc16f800): JavaThread "ModalContext" [_thread_in_native, id=29087, stack(0x00007feace8bc000,0x00007feace9bd000)] 
siginfo:si_signo=SIGSEGV: si_errno=0, si_code=128(), si_addr=0x0000000000000000 
... 
... 
uname:Linux 2.6.38.8-621 #2 SMP Wed Sep 14 13:43:05 PDT 2011 x86_64 
libc:glibc 2.11.1 NPTL 2.11.1 
rlimit: STACK 8192k, CORE 0k, NPROC 32768, NOFILE 32768, AS infinity 
load average:0.07 0.12 0.12 
+0

この問題はありませんでした(とにかくDebianを使用しています)。どのUbuntuのバージョン? – m0skit0

+0

あなたのUbuntuのJVM(および他のパッケージ)が最新であることを確認してください。 –

答えて

2

ファイルのUbuntuのバグレポート: 2.openアンドロイド仮想デバイス

エラー・ログには、複雑なようです。エラーログからエラーを報告してここに投稿する場合は、バグレポートを提出するときにに残しておいてください。このエラーログには、バグを見つけるのに十分な情報が掲載されていません。

プログラムによって実行されているJNIコードにバグがありますが、このエラーログにはそれを検出するための必要なデータがありません。

+0

+1クラッシュを再現できる場合は、手順を教えてください。興味があります。 –

+0

ありがとう、私のJVMは32ビットですが、日食は64ビットですので、問題は解決しました.JVMはsegvになっていないはずです。 – MrROY

0

JavaのEclipseだけがOracleの実装でテストされているようです。 これをインストールしてください(おそらく、最後の1.6.xバージョンを使用するのが最善でしょう)。eclipseがそれを使用していることを確認してください(デフォルトまたはeclipse.iniで指定されています)。

関連する問題